A gas detector is a critical safety device designed to monitor and detect the presence of hazardous, toxic, or combustible gases in the environment. When gas levels exceed safe limits, the device triggers an audible and/or visual alarm, allowing immediate action to prevent accidents, fires, or health risks.
Gas detectors are commonly used in residential, commercial, and industrial settings, including kitchens, factories, laboratories, parking areas, and confined spaces. They are essential for detecting gases such as LPG, natural gas (methane), carbon monoxide (CO), hydrogen sulfide, and other potentially dangerous substances.
These devices operate using various sensing technologies, including electrochemical, catalytic, infrared, and semiconductor sensors, each suited for detecting specific types of gases. Some advanced models can monitor multiple gases simultaneously and provide real-time readings.
Gas detectors can be portable or fixed installations, depending on the application. Fixed systems are often integrated with alarm systems, ventilation controls, or automatic shutdown mechanisms to enhance safety.
Regular calibration and maintenance are important to ensure accuracy and reliability. Proper placement of the detector is also critical for effective gas detection.
